A fairly decent FPS shooter

Being a successor to the original Blake Stone: Alien of gold, it has all the features that it had except for the elevator. The goal in the game is now to collect different bombs and then to bring these bombs to the security circle so that they can explode and allow you to use the exit. There is a variety of 24 new levels in the game and the gameplay is quite linear. It has all the guns which the previous game had and also gives you some new guns which are quite impactful. The plasma discharger is the latest addition to the weaponry in the game and is really destructive and fun to use. In terms of the level designs, they are quite distinct from each other and has a good variety of distinct enemies that have been dispersed between these levels and really give you a tough time on controls. Similarly there are some new bosses which are really tough to beat and you also have some very good power ups which enable you to counter the enemies more effectively. The graphics are a lot smoother than the original versions and the UI is also better comparatively. So you can call it as a good upgrade which is not basically an upgrade but a turn over.
